mirror of
				https://github.com/kevinveenbirkenbach/computer-playbook.git
				synced 2025-11-04 04:08:15 +00:00 
			
		
		
		
	
		
			
				
	
	
		
			20 lines
		
	
	
		
			620 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
			
		
		
	
	
			20 lines
		
	
	
		
			620 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
- name: create docker-compose.yml for bigbluebutton
 | 
						|
  command:
 | 
						|
    cmd: bash ./scripts/generate-compose
 | 
						|
    chdir: "{{ docker_repository_path }}"
 | 
						|
  environment:
 | 
						|
    COMPOSE_HTTP_TIMEOUT: 600
 | 
						|
    DOCKER_CLIENT_TIMEOUT: 600
 | 
						|
 | 
						|
- name: Slurp docker-compose.yml from remote host
 | 
						|
  slurp:
 | 
						|
    src: "{{ docker_compose_file_origine }}"
 | 
						|
  register: compose_slurp
 | 
						|
 | 
						|
- name: Transform docker-compose.yml with compose_mods
 | 
						|
  copy:
 | 
						|
    content: "{{ compose_slurp.content | b64decode | compose_mods(docker_repository_path, docker_compose.files.env) }}"
 | 
						|
    dest: "{{ docker_compose_file_final }}"
 | 
						|
  notify:
 | 
						|
    - docker compose just up
 |